Bunaken National Marine Park
Just a short trip from Sario lies Bunaken National Marine Park, a diver's paradise renowned for its incredible biodiversity. Explore vibrant coral reefs teeming with colourful fish, and maybe even spot a sea turtle or two. It's an absolute must for anyone who loves the underwater world.
Lake Tondano
Escape the city bustle and head to the serene Lake Tondano. Enjoy breathtaking views, take a leisurely boat ride, or simply relax by the water's edge. It's a perfect spot for a peaceful afternoon.
Manado Tua Island
A short boat trip away, Manado Tua Island offers stunning volcanic landscapes and pristine beaches. Hike to the summit for panoramic views, or simply unwind on the beach and soak up the sun. It's a great day trip from Sario.

When’s the Best Time to Go?
Sario enjoys a tropical climate, meaning it's generally warm and sunny year-round. The dry season (April-October) offers the best weather for outdoor activities, while the wet season (November-March) can bring occasional rain showers.
